Rep. Maria Elvira Salazar Buys Shares of SpaceX (NASDAQ:SPCX)

by · The Markets Daily

Representative Maria Elvira Salazar (Republican-Florida) recently bought shares of SpaceX (NASDAQ:SPCX). In a filing disclosed on September 09th, the Representative disclosed that they had bought between $1,001 and $15,000 in SpaceX stock on August 12th. The trade occurred in the Representative’s “UBS IRA ACCOUNT” account.

About Representative Salazar

Maria Elvira Salazar (Republican Party) is a member of the U.S. House, representing Florida’s 27th Congressional District. She assumed office on January 3, 2021. Her current term ends on January 3, 2027.

Salazar (Republican Party) ran for re-election to the U.S. House to represent Florida’s 27th Congressional District. She won in the general election on November 5, 2024.

Maria Elvira Salazar was born in Miami, Florida, and lives in Coral Gables, Florida. Salazar earned an undergraduate degree from the University of Miami in 1983 and a graduate degree from Harvard University in 1995. Her career experience includes working as a television journalist, reporter, and news anchor.

About SpaceX

Space Exploration Technologies Corp. (SpaceX) is a privately held aerospace company founded in 2002 by Elon Musk. The company develops and operates launch vehicles, spacecraft and satellite systems, serving commercial, government and scientific customers.

SpaceX’s principal products include the Falcon 9 and Falcon Heavy rockets, which are used to launch satellites, spacecraft and other payloads into orbit. The company also develops the Dragon spacecraft, which supports cargo and crew missions to low Earth orbit, including missions for NASA and other customers.

Through its Starlink business, SpaceX operates a large constellation of low Earth orbit satellites that provides broadband internet service to customers in numerous countries and regions.
